General description
Whatman cellulose acetate membranes are made from pure cellulose acetate making them suitable for biological and clinical analysis, sterility tests, and scintillation measurements.
Cellulose acetate membrane filters exhibit very low protein binding capacity. They are hydrophilic making them suitable for aqueous and alcoholic media. The cellulose acetate membranes have improved solvent resistance, particularly to low molecular weight alcohols and increased heat resistance. With high physical strength, the membrane filters can be used up to 180ºC, are suitable for hot gases, and can be sterilized by all methods without sacrificing the integrity of the membrane.
